Hey guys, so last week i decided to plastidip my whole car. the reason i did it was because i had a good friend that actually did it himself, and it turned out really well and had no problems with plastidip on his whole car (after 2 years). also, i suggest you guys check out dipyourcar.com and their youtube videos if you're interested! (that's where we got the dip)

my friend and I have actually painted about 4-5 cars so far, and we're constantly getting new people who want us to paint their cars. but anyways, here are some pics.

bunnyrun wrote:Look so cool. How long does it take and does it go back to the original color if I removed the dip? How much?
Yup you can peel it off when you want. Its about $250 for just the paint + shipping, but you need equipment like spray gun and masks and all that stuff so it would cost a bit more.
